Management Meeting Minutes — Retirement of the Cobblefern Line

Present: Ruth Abelard, Jonas Pell, branch leads. We agreed Cobblefern units stop shipping at quarter-end; spares support runs twelve more months. Branches should run down stock rather than discount aggressively — Jonas will circulate talking points for customers. Migration offers to the Thornvale range were approved in principle. What this means for next year's direction is noted below.

management briefing: Jorixax Holdings is in early talks to buy Casixax Holdings for about $420.3 million. The Fenmir launch date is October 27, and nothing goes to the press before then. Legal wants the Keloxek Foods term sheet redrafted before April 16.

Runbook: Packrun optimizer — stalled batches

Symptom: pick lists stop generating; queue depth climbs on the Velmory dashboard.

Steps: check solver health endpoint, then restart the worker pool if solve time exceeds 90s. Do not clear the queue — batches replay automatically. Escalate to the routing team if restarts loop twice. Verify the running instance against the expected configuration values below.

service settings:
quenath:
  log_level: info
  metrics_host: metrics.quenath.tolvaqlabs.internal
  pin: 1407
  pool_size: 8

### Prefetcher for map tiles — please poke holes

Hey, this adds a speculative tile prefetcher to Wayfinch so panning around the Corvell Harbor demo doesn't stutter. The idea: when the viewport velocity crosses a threshold, we fetch a ring of tiles in the movement direction, capped by a memory budget so low-end devices don't fall over. I benchmarked on the Pellgrove dataset and cold-pan jank dropped a lot. Main thing I want eyes on is the eviction logic. Tuning values I landed on are below.

limits module of fajog-tawig:
RATE_LIMITS = {
    "druwyn": 2,
    "quenael": 10,
    "wenix": 2,
    "druael": 2,
}

Fleet fuel-usage report (Haulrix): runs nightly at 02:10 via the Cartwain scheduler. If totals look off, check the odometer dedupe step first — duplicates inflate burn rates. Rerun with --window=7d only; longer windows hit the cold-storage tier. Escalate to the Fleet Metrics rotation if two consecutive runs fail. The failing run's build token is printed below.

session token of yajof-bagef = htk4_937d